Getting started with a Virtual IOP in Lyndhurst is simple and straightforward. Most programs offer sessions 3-5 days a week, averaging 9-20 hours of therapy per week. Individuals can engage in individual therapy, group sessions, or family-oriented approaches, all conducted through HIPAA-compliant video conferencing platforms.
